BZT52C9V1LS-TP Parametric

Parameter NameAttribute value
Is it Rohs certified?conform to
Objectid8222734214
Reach Compliance Codecompliant
ECCN codeEAR99
Diode typeZENER DIODE
Maximum dynamic impedance15 Ω
JESD-609 codee3
Maximum knee impedance100 Ω
Humidity sensitivity level1
Peak Reflow Temperature (Celsius)260
Maximum power dissipation0.2 W
Nominal reference voltage9.1 V
Maximum reverse current0.0005 µA
Terminal surfaceMATTE TIN
Maximum time at peak reflow temperature10
Working test current5 mA

Note: 1.
Halogen free "Green” products are defined as those which contain <900ppm bromine,
<900ppm chlorine (<1500ppm total Br + Cl) and <1000ppm antimony compounds.
